How Pallet Recycling Benefits Businesses
Pallet recycling is a critical component of sustainable logistics. Instead of discarding damaged or surplus pallets, recycling programs allow pallets to be repaired, refurbished, or responsibly processed for reuse. This approach extends the life cycle of pallets while reducing landfill waste.
Through pallet sales and recycling programs, businesses can access affordable recycled pallets without sacrificing performance. Recycled pallets are carefully inspected and repaired to meet usage standards, making them a cost-effective alternative to purchasing new pallets for every shipment.
Cost Savings Through Pallet Sales and Recycling
One of the biggest advantages of pallet sales and recycling is cost control. Recycled pallets typically cost less than new pallets, offering immediate savings for businesses that ship at high volumes. Over time, recycling programs help reduce disposal costs and lower overall pallet expenses.
By working with a provider that offers both pallet sales and recycling, businesses can create a closed-loop system. Used pallets are collected, repaired, and returned to circulation, minimizing waste while maximizing value.

Quality and Safety in Recycled Pallets
A professional pallet sales and recycling program prioritizes quality and safety. Recycled pallets are inspected to ensure they meet structural standards before being resold. Damaged components are replaced, and pallets that cannot be repaired are responsibly processed.
This focus on quality ensures that recycled pallets perform reliably in real-world conditions. Businesses benefit from safe, dependable pallets while supporting sustainable practices.
